External Male Catheter for Home Use: A Comprehensive Guide

As healthcare needs evolve, the demand for convenient and effective home care solutions continues to grow. One such solution is the external male catheter, a device designed to assist individuals with urinary incontinence or other urinary issues in a non-invasive manner. These catheters are particularly beneficial for those who wish to maintain independence and privacy while managing their condition at home. Unlike traditional catheters that require insertion into the body, external male catheters are worn outside the body, offering a less invasive option that reduces the risk of infection and discomfort. They are typically made from soft, flexible materials that ensure comfort and are designed to be worn discreetly under clothing.

Types of External Male Catheters

There are several types of external male catheters available, each designed to meet different needs and preferences:

  • Self-Adhesive Catheters: These catheters come with an adhesive lining that allows them to securely attach to the skin. They are easy to apply and remove, making them a popular choice for many users.
  • Non-Adhesive Catheters: These catheters require an external strap or adhesive strip to hold them in place. They are suitable for individuals with sensitive skin or those who prefer not to use adhesives.
  • Reusable Catheters: Made from durable materials, these catheters can be cleaned and reused multiple times, offering an eco-friendly and cost-effective option.
  • Disposable Catheters: Designed for single use, these catheters are convenient and hygienic, reducing the risk of infection and skin irritation.

Benefits of Using External Male Catheters

External male catheters offer several advantages, making them an attractive option for home use:

  • Non-Invasive: Unlike internal catheters, external catheters do not require insertion into the body, minimizing discomfort and the risk of urinary tract infections.
  • Comfortable: Made from soft, flexible materials, these catheters are designed to be worn comfortably for extended periods.
  • Discreet: External catheters can be worn discreetly under clothing, allowing users to maintain privacy and dignity.
  • Convenient: They provide a simple solution for managing urinary incontinence, enabling users to carry on with their daily activities without interruption.

Considerations for Choosing an External Male Catheter

When selecting an external male catheter, it is important to consider several factors to ensure the best fit and performance:

  • Size and Fit: Proper sizing is crucial for comfort and effectiveness. Catheters are available in various sizes, so it is important to choose one that fits well.
  • Material: Consider the material of the catheter, especially if you have sensitive skin or allergies. Silicone and latex are common materials used in these devices.
  • Adhesive Strength: The adhesive should be strong enough to keep the catheter in place but gentle enough to avoid skin irritation.
  • Usage Frequency: Decide whether you prefer a reusable or disposable catheter based on your lifestyle and budget.
